SUNNILAND OIL FIELD

Collier County · dedicated 1971 · Oil Well Park Rd, just before S.R. 29 in unmarked park, Sunniland

Get directions ↗

The first commercial oil well in Florida, located just east of this site, was drilled in 1943 by Humble Oil and Refining Company. The discovery of oil at a depth of over 11,500 feet proved that there was oil in Florida. Seventeen wells were subsequently drilled near here. Sunniland was the state's only commercial oil field until 1964 although there had been extensive drilling since 1900. A vision of Barron Gift Collier was thus fulfilled.
